On August 26th, Hyperliquid’s co-founder, Jeff Yan, quietly announced that manual lending is now live on the HyperCore testnet. The headlines will tell you this is just another feature rollout. But if you look past the press release and into the architecture, this isn't a feature. It's a declaration of intent. This is Hyperliquid telling the market it no longer wants to be just a derivatives DEX. It wants to be the settlement layer for your entire financial life. And that ambition carries a weight most traders won't feel until it's too late.
To understand what's happening, you have to forget everything you know about modular DeFi. This isn't Aave deploying a new pool on an app chain. Hyperliquid is embedding lending directly into its L1 core system—HyperCore—and exposing it to the broader ecosystem through a mechanism called CoreWriter and a set of read-only precompiled contracts. In plain English: HyperEVM smart contracts can now call lending functions that live inside the core protocol itself, not in a separate application contract.
This is an architectural choice that deserves more scrutiny than it's getting. On one hand, it's elegant. Integrating lending into the consensus layer means capital efficiency could theoretically be higher, because the system can see your entire position across trading and borrowing simultaneously. It's the difference between a bank that only knows your mortgage and a bank that watches your paycheck, your credit card, and your investments in real-time. On the other hand, it creates a dependency that makes me deeply uneasy. Every developer building on HyperEVM is now trusting that the Hyperliquid core team will maintain those precompiled contracts forever, without bugs, without malicious upgrades, and without a governance attack.

Based on that experience, the security assumption here is inverted. In a traditional DeFi protocol like Aave, the lending logic is open source and governed by a decentralized token vote, even if that vote is often performative. Here, the lending logic sits behind CoreWriter—a precompile controlled by the core system. That is a honeypot. It's a single point of failure wrapped in a high-performance execution engine. The team is technically brilliant, but brilliance doesn't stop a malicious actor from exploiting a subtle rounding error in a liquidation curve.
The timing is also worth examining. We are in a bull market. Euphoria masks technical flaws. This is exactly the moment when teams ship features to capture mindshare, hoping that the security audits catch up later. The announcement notes that mainnet lending is still limited to portfolio margin mode. That's a cautious, staged rollout—I'll give them that. But it also means the most dangerous logic (isolated liquidation, collateral swapping, and interest rate modeling) hasn't been battle-tested. The testnet is where they'll invite the white-hat hackers, but the reality is that the most sophisticated exploits usually happen months after a mainnet launch, when the community gets complacent.
I want to challenge the prevailing narrative that this makes Hyperliquid the 'super-app chain' of DeFi. That is the bull case. The bear case is more subtle. By moving lending into the core, Hyperliquid is essentially becoming a centralized bank with a decentralized front-end. The network effects are real—more features attract more users, which attracts more developers—but this flywheel only spins if the core team remains benevolent. The moment they make a mistake, the entire ecosystem collapses, not just one isolated app. That fragility is the price of vertical integration.

The contrarian take is that this is actually a good thing. For the first time, we might have a lending protocol that can be properly regulated because it has a clear legal entity to point to. The CFTC or SEC doesn't know how to sue a DAO. But they know exactly how to subpoena a centralized core team that controls lending and derivatives on the same platform. This could accelerate institutional adoption faster than any decentralized governance model. It's a trade-off: we trade the illusion of decentralization for the reality of legal accountability.
If you can see past the testnet hype, the real signal is this: Hyperliquid is betting that the future of finance is vertical, not horizontal. They are betting that users want one platform for everything, even if that means trusting the platform. I'm not convinced that's the right bet.
